Problems 59 - 62 refer to the following experiment: 2 balls are drawn in succession out of a box containing 2 red and 5 white balls. Let R i , be the event that the i t h ball is red, and let W i , be the event that the i t h ball is white. Construct a probability tree for this experiment and find the probability of each of the events R 1 ∩ R 2 , R 1 ∩ W 2 , W 1 ∩ R 2 , W 1 ∩ W 2 , , given that the first ball drawn was (A) Replaced before the second draw (B) Not replaced before the second draw
